March 16 – 17, 2020 News Release

Shoplifting

On March 16th, 2020 at 1:00 p.m. the Brockville Police Service responded to Walmart on Parkedale Ave. for a shoplifting complaint.  The loss prevention officer had observed a 36 year old female committing the theft and arrested her when she left the store.  The responding officers continued the arrest as she was also wanted for failing to attend court.  She was held in custody pending a bail hearing.

 

Impaired

On March 16th, 2020 at 5:00 p.m. the Brockville Police Service received a complaint of a possible impaired driver.  Officers located and arrested a 61 year old local male for impaired operation of a conveyance.  He was charged and issued a future court date.  The male is also subject to an automatic 90 day driver’s licence suspension and a 7 day vehicle impound.

 

Warrant:

On March 16th at 5:30 p.m. a 56 year old male was observed by officers at the Real Canadian Superstore.  The male was known to the officers who had information that a probation warrant had been issued for his arrest.  The male was arrested without incident and issued a new court date to answer to the charge.

 

Robbery:

On March 17th, 2020 at 5:15 a.m. the Brockville Police Service responded to 250 King St. West “Circle K” convenience store for a robbery.  A lone male entered the store, brandished a weapon and demanded money.  The store clerk was not physically harmed.  The suspect is described as male white; 5’10 stocky build dressed in black had his face covered. More details will become available as the investigation proceeds.  Any witnesses or anyone with information is asked to contact the Brockville Police Service at 613-342-0127 or call Crime Stoppers at 1-800-222-TIPS (8477).
